Hawaii's JJ Mandaquit Commits to Arizona After USA Basketball Stint

Guard JJ Mandaquit, a Hawaii product, has committed to play for Tommy Lloyd at the University of Arizona. Mandaquit's standout performance with USA Basketball last summer caught Lloyd's attention.
The University of Arizona is set to welcome a new talent in guard JJ Mandaquit, who has announced his commitment to play for coach Tommy Lloyd. Mandaquit, originally from Hawaii, will bring his skills to the Pac-12 program after a period that fostered a connection with Lloyd.
Mandaquit's path to Arizona wasn't direct, but it was a series of experiences that ultimately led him to Tucson. His recruitment gained significant momentum following his participation with USA Basketball last summer, where his playmaking and scoring ability reportedly impressed the Wildcats' head coach.
